- The distance between Birmingham, Alabama, Usa and St Georges, French Guiana is approximately 4,896 km or 3,043 mi.
- To reach Birmingham, Alabama in this distance one would set out from St Georges bearing 316.6°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Birmingham, Alabama bearing 304.7° or NW .
- Birmingham, Alabama has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as St Georges has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Birmingham, Alabama is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as St Georges is in or near the subtropical wet for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 9.3 °C (16.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.8 °C (35.6°F) more in Birmingham, Alabama.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2131.6 mm (83.9 in) less which is equivalent to 2131.6 l/m² (52.31 US gal/ft²) or 21,316,000 l/ha (2,278,822 US gal/ac) less. About 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.2° lower in Birmingham, Alabama than in St Georges.
